The precision (measured in “bits”, computed as ) and the exponent size (also measured in “bits,” computed as , where is the maximum exponent value) is recommended to be at least as great as the values in the next figure. Each of the defined subtypes of type float might or might not have a minus zero.
| Format | Minimum Precision | Minimum Exponent Size |
| Short | 13 bits | 5 bits |
| Single | 24 bits | 8 bits |
| Double | 50 bits | 8 bits |
| Long | 50 bits | 8 bits |
Figure 12–11. Recommended Minimum Floating-Point Precision and Exponent Size

short-float [short-lower-limit [short-upper-limit]]
single-float [single-lower-limit [single-upper-limit]]
double-float [double-lower-limit [double-upper-limit]]
long-float [long-lower-limit [long-upper-limit]]
short-lower-limit, short-upper-limit—interval designators for type short-float. The defaults for each of lower-limit and upper-limit is the symbol *.
single-lower-limit, single-upper-limit—interval designators for type single-float. The defaults for each of lower-limit and upper-limit is the symbol *.
double-lower-limit, double-upper-limit—interval designators for type double-float. The defaults for each of lower-limit and upper-limit is the symbol *.
long-lower-limit, long-upper-limit—interval designators for type long-float. The defaults for each of lower-limit and upper-limit is the symbol *.
Each of these denotes the set of floats of the indicated type that are on the interval specified by the interval designators.
